Half way there!

Organisers of the 2010 SIG Insulations Sheffield Half Marathon have announced that the race is half way to hitting its target of 5,500 runners – at the earliest point to date.

Sheffield’s sporting spectacular has already attracted 2,750 runners, with more than three months still to go until race day.

The race has reached the milestone figure way ahead of the 2009 event, with numbers up by 840 from the same time last year.

Ian Thomas, entries coordinator for the Sheffield Half Marathon, said: “It is fantastic to see entries coming in thick and fast and it seems we are on track to reach entry limit well before race day for the second year in a row.

“People often wait until just before the race to sign up, but to avoid disappointment we encourage people to enter sooner rather than later so they don’t miss out! The race is becoming increasingly popular year after year and people are keener than ever to raise funds for some fantastic local causes.”

The SIG Insulations Sheffield Half Marathon and 3k Fun Run will take place on 25 April 2010 at Sheffield International Venues (SIV) managed facility Don Valley Stadium from 9:30am.
